Dead Sea Works workers have ended their sanctions amid ongoing fighting between Israel and the Hamas in the Gaza Strip. The sanctions ended earlier this week and may be connected to the emergency situation in Israel.
Rockets have been fired from the Gaza Strip at southern Israel including areas where Israel Chemicals Ltd. has production plants. However, other than stopping work at the time of alerts the fighting has had no impact on production or exports. Ashdod, the main port for exports to Europe, the U.S., and Latin America, has been the target of dozens of rockets. Many have been intercepted by the Iron Dome system. Work at Ashdod port has continued and ICL said that its exports from the port have not been hit by the ongoing tension.
The sanctions went on for four weeks and were described as ‘sporadic.’ They had only a minor impact on potash shipments.
